gamesh411 wrote:

As you suspected, no hits for ParamVarRegion or StringRegion.
ParamVarRegion may not even be possible to encounter in this context (just a 
guess), and I am not sure where is binding to a String region occurs. I will 
remove these two cases for now.

```
   38|       |bool StoreToImmutableChecker::isConstVariable(const MemRegion *MR,
   39|     21|                                              CheckerContext &C) 
const {
   40|       |  // Check if the region is in the global immutable space
   41|     21|  const MemSpaceRegion *MS = MR->getMemorySpace(C.getState());
   42|     21|  if (isa<GlobalImmutableSpaceRegion>(MS))
   43|      3|    return true;
   44|       |
   45|       |  // Check if this is a VarRegion with a const-qualified type
   46|     18|  if (const VarRegion *VR = dyn_cast<VarRegion>(MR)) {
   47|      8|    const VarDecl *VD = VR->getDecl();
   48|      8|    if (VD && VD->getType().isConstQualified())
   49|      2|      return true;
   50|      8|  }
   51|       |
   52|       |  // Check if this is a ParamVarRegion with a const-qualified type
   53|     16|  if (const ParamVarRegion *PVR = dyn_cast<ParamVarRegion>(MR)) {
   54|      0|    const ParmVarDecl *PVD = PVR->getDecl();
   55|      0|    if (PVD && PVD->getType().isConstQualified())
   56|      0|      return true;
   57|      0|  }
   58|       |
   59|       |  // Check if this is a FieldRegion with a const-qualified type
   60|     16|  if (const FieldRegion *FR = dyn_cast<FieldRegion>(MR)) {
   61|      5|    const FieldDecl *FD = FR->getDecl();
   62|      5|    if (FD && FD->getType().isConstQualified())
   63|      4|      return true;
   64|      5|  }
   65|       |
   66|       |  // Check if this is a StringRegion (string literals are const)
   67|     12|  if (isa<StringRegion>(MR))
   68|      0|    return true;
   69|       |
   70|       |  // Check if this is a SymbolicRegion with a const-qualified 
pointee type
   71|     12|  if (const SymbolicRegion *SR = dyn_cast<SymbolicRegion>(MR)) {
   72|      3|    QualType PointeeType = SR->getPointeeStaticType();
   73|      3|    if (PointeeType.isConstQualified())
   74|      3|      return true;
   75|      3|  }
   76|       |
   77|       |  // Check if this is an ElementRegion accessing a const array
   78|      9|  if (const ElementRegion *ER = dyn_cast<ElementRegion>(MR)) {
   79|      2|    return isConstQualifiedType(ER->getSuperRegion(), C);
   80|      2|  }
   81|       |
   82|      7|  return false;
   83|      9|}

```
